作者:禪與計(jì)算機(jī)程序設(shè)計(jì)藝術(shù)
1.簡(jiǎn)介
隨著互聯(lián)網(wǎng)、移動(dòng)互聯(lián)網(wǎng)和物聯(lián)網(wǎng)技術(shù)的飛速發(fā)展,數(shù)據(jù)量呈爆炸式增長,這給傳統(tǒng)數(shù)據(jù)庫系統(tǒng)遇到的新問題提出了更加復(fù)雜的挑戰(zhàn)。為了應(yīng)對(duì)這一挑戰(zhàn),區(qū)塊鏈技術(shù)應(yīng)運(yùn)而生,它是一個(gè)分布式數(shù)據(jù)庫系統(tǒng),它解決了容錯(cuò)和防篡改的問題,并且提供了不可變的數(shù)據(jù)存儲(chǔ)方式。但是,對(duì)于區(qū)塊鏈系統(tǒng)來說,它的系統(tǒng)擴(kuò)展性和可靠性是一個(gè)非常重要的方面。這兩點(diǎn)在設(shè)計(jì)和實(shí)施區(qū)塊鏈系統(tǒng)時(shí),都需要特別關(guān)注。因此,本文將詳細(xì)闡述區(qū)塊鏈系統(tǒng)的擴(kuò)展性和可靠性。
2.基本概念術(shù)語說明
2.1 數(shù)據(jù)分布式
數(shù)據(jù)分布式(Data Distribution)是指在多臺(tái)計(jì)算機(jī)之間分配、存儲(chǔ)和管理數(shù)據(jù)的過程。舉個(gè)例子,假設(shè)一個(gè)應(yīng)用程序要存儲(chǔ)一份數(shù)據(jù),則可以把這個(gè)數(shù)據(jù)分成若干份分別存放在不同的服務(wù)器上。這些服務(wù)器并不一定要同處于同一網(wǎng)絡(luò)環(huán)境中。用戶可以通過Internet連接到任一臺(tái)服務(wù)器上并讀取或者修改該數(shù)據(jù)。數(shù)據(jù)分布式就是這種方式。
2.2 分布式數(shù)據(jù)庫系統(tǒng)
分布式數(shù)據(jù)庫系統(tǒng)(Distributed Database Systems),是指采用分布式計(jì)算機(jī)網(wǎng)絡(luò)對(duì)數(shù)據(jù)庫進(jìn)行高度共享的系統(tǒng)。這種系統(tǒng)中的每個(gè)節(jié)點(diǎn)都儲(chǔ)存整個(gè)數(shù)據(jù)庫的一部分,且所有節(jié)點(diǎn)之間都能夠通信交流。一般情況下,每臺(tái)服務(wù)器上的數(shù)據(jù)庫只有很少的一部分?jǐn)?shù)據(jù)是真正有效的,其他部分?jǐn)?shù)據(jù)被冗余備份。分布式數(shù)據(jù)庫系統(tǒng)通過數(shù)據(jù)分布式技術(shù)實(shí)現(xiàn)了對(duì)海量數(shù)據(jù)的高效率訪問,并提供了容錯(cuò)和性能優(yōu)化等功能。文章來源:http://www.zghlxwxcb.cn/news/detail-719867.html
2.3 CAP定理
CAP定理(CAP theorem)描述的是一個(gè)分布式系統(tǒng)在某個(gè)分布式節(jié)點(diǎn)故障時(shí)仍然可以保證數(shù)據(jù)一致性的能力。在分布式數(shù)據(jù)庫系統(tǒng)中,一般采文章來源地址http://www.zghlxwxcb.cn/news/detail-719867.html
到了這里,關(guān)于可擴(kuò)展性和可靠性:區(qū)塊鏈的特性使得它可以極大地滿足應(yīng)用場(chǎng)景的需要,但是同時(shí)也帶來了新的挑戰(zhàn)——系統(tǒng)的可擴(kuò)展性的文章就介紹完了。如果您還想了解更多內(nèi)容,請(qǐng)?jiān)谟疑辖撬阉鱐OY模板網(wǎng)以前的文章或繼續(xù)瀏覽下面的相關(guān)文章,希望大家以后多多支持TOY模板網(wǎng)!